Web5 apr. 2024 · Club fitting is the process of customising golf clubs to fit the individual needs of a golfer. During the club fitting process, a professional fitter will assess your swing style, body type, and skill level to determine the optimal specifications for your golf clubs. These specifications include length, weight, loft angle, lie angle, shaft flex ... A golf glove should fit snugly without wrinkles or creases, working with the grip on the individual clubs to give you the … WebIf the toe of the club touches the ground first, the ball will tend to start right of the target (for right-handed golfers). If the heel of the club touches the ground first, then the ball will …
